Daniel Ricciardo Lands in Faenza to Threaten Nyck de Vries’ ‘Once in Lifetime’ F1 Opportunity
Nyck de Vries was lobbied by Max Verstappen himself in front of the Red Bull bosses to give him his one F1 opportunity, for which he has been waiting ever since he won his F2 championship in 2019. However, his rookie year in the sport has been nothing but underwhelming. So much so that his seat at AlphaTauri is under threat, and now Daniel Ricciardo landing in Faenza should worry the Dutchman.
In the first five races, Vries has brought no points back for his team. Whereas his teammate Yuki Tsunoda has been decent and, with much hard work, has managed to get two points.
Daniel Ricciardo is in Faenza the home of AlphaTauri Formula 1 team and he is not there for a vacation.

But the Dutchman’s performances now keep him last in the table, which wouldn’t be acceptable to his bosses. Therefore, as per a report by AUTOMOTO from Italy, Ricciardo could replace Vries in the team, as the former Red Bull driver even passed a seat test at Faenza.
Daniel Ricciardo could say goodbye to his sabbatical
When McLaren axed Ricciardo at the end of the last season, he didn’t stop for offers from other teams as he wished not to be in a car in 2023. Instead, he planned on a sabbatical in which he wanted to do things he never got to do amidst the hectic F1 schedule.
In short, he wanted to stay away from an F1 car. However, a new development can change his entire decision, considering if Vries continues to perform like this, he can be axed by AlphaTauri in the middle of the season.

On the other hand, Ricciardo is currently the third driver at Red Bull. So, if his team decides to perform for their sister team, he’ll be obligated to do so. But surely, times are worrisome for Vries at the moment.
What about returning to the top?
When F1 visited Australia this year, Ricciardo was a big highlight, even though he wasn’t on the grid. Many asked about his possible return to the grid, and he said that he wants to be back with a top team and not with a side that only fights for single-digit points.
But AlphaTauri is the opposite of what Ricciardo wants. In fact, it could never topple Red Bull as the top side within their own fraternity; forget about it ever being a top three side.
So it remains to be seen whether Ricciardo would step back from his own words to ensure his F1 entry. Moreover, with AlphaTauri, he could pip himself to be the de-facto replacement to any driver that leaves Red Bull.
